    Merchant accounts are actually bank accounts that are specifically designed for such accounts to accept credit card transactions. Credit card payments can be made at either a physical store or through an online store.
    A merchant who owns an online business that is related to online casinos, adult content or even paid online media are considered to be “high risk” in its nature. High sales volume and turnovers make credit card frauds happen more commonly than usual. Hence, these businesses are considered to be risky. This results in banks not willing to provide such merchants with an account. And in order for these merchants to get an account, they turn to domestic merchant account providers to provide them with a high risk merchant account. Most merchants who deal with customers “offshore” would preferably choose an offshore merchant account provider to provide them with a high risk offshore merchant account.

    Student credit cards have been criticized over the years; people incorrectly assume that credit card companies are targeting needy students. The truth is that a credit card is much like a weapon, in responsible hands it can be useful, but in the wrong hands it can be misused. There is no denying that student credit cards are available to younger individuals, but the fact that most student credit cards usually require a co-signer ensures student credit cards are used under supervision. In addition, most student credit cards have a low credit limit making it difficult for a student to overspend.
